Responsibilities

This position will oversee the operations of 3-4 warehouse / distribution facilities. They will develop strategic initiatives for the region that align to the overall logistics vision. They will be accountable for the operation of the facilities including its financial results customer delivery safety quality equipment inventory labor and productivity. They must drive results within their facilities through staff development cost savings and effective leadership while exceeding customer requirements.

Responsibilities:

Drives warehouse productivity & process improvements to achieve cost savings

Budget & forecast ownership for region

Accountable for regional achievement of KPI Results

Develops strategies to mitigate impact of volume surges & capacity constraints

Implements network optimization and product deployment plans

Project ownership develop & drive key network-wide initiatives

Sales team & customer; collaboration and engagement

Supply Chain cross-functional collaboration

Develops leadership team at each regional facility

Provides guidance and input in the development of policies guidelines and procedures to ensure quality and cost control

Works with site Operations Manager to review and manage site financials provide monthly cost forecasts understand site variances inform stake holders of site financial performance

Ensures safety in the workspace by conducting safety audits & safety observations documents and addresses root cause of incidents and near misses encourages a safety orientated culture throughout the facility

Lead Tier 2 meetings ensuring standard work is followed and all issues and problems are resolved or routed appropriately

Understands the cost drivers at the sites and works to minimize and reduce costs without sacrificing quality or customer deliveries

Point of escalation for any problems issues or adjustments as required to complete the operations plan and ensure on time customer shipments

Monitors site KPIs and works with team to resolve any shortfalls and create corrective actions

Liaison to senior leadership manufacturing facility & corporate support staff

Qualifications

Qualifications

BA/BS Degree preferred in logistics or related field

7-10 years of management experience in Distribution/Warehouse Logistics; Multi-site management a plus

Proven success in improving Warehouse performance

Strong leadership and interpersonal skills

Experience with Warehouse Management Systems (WMS); JDA (Red Prairie) a plus

Experience with Enterprise Resource Planning Systems (ERP); SAP a plus

Self-Directed & demonstrates the ability to proactively identify and resolve discrepancies or potential issues

Excellent written and verbal communication skills

Detail orientated with high analytical ability

Demonstrated financial acumen

Excellent problem identification & follow through to issue resolution

Strong organizational skills with the ability to multi-task and prioritize

Demonstrates the ability to work well with a variety of individuals

Demonstrates an understanding of automated distribution
